“Far better it is to dare mighty things, to win glorious triumphs, even though checkered by failure, than to take rank with those poor souls who neither enjoy much nor suffer much, because they live in the gray twilight that knows neither victory nor defeat.” –Theodore Roosevelt

Never be afraid to take risks; to have the courage to pursue your dreams; to take the chance of failing at something. Failure is really never possible unless you simply quit trying – until then, it is simply a delay on your journey to success. Successful people not only dream big, but DO big as well – when you dream big and complete big actions to follow those dreams, success won’t be too far behind.

“Look at a day when you are supremely satisfied at the end. It’s not a day when you lounge around doing nothing, it’s when you’ve had everything to do and you’ve done it!” –Margaret Thatcher

As a procrastinator at heart, I love this quote. It’s a great motivator for me as I go through my day to keep to the task at hand, knowing that at the end of the day as I’m climbing into bed I will be able to let out a sigh of satisfaction at what I’ve completed rather than one of dread of the day to come. Remember this quote, and remember this feeling as you go about your seemingly-endless daily tasks – know that in the end, it will be worth it!
